It is a good college with great infrastructure, faculty members, facilities and placements.
Placements: Almost every student gets placed in a good company from our college. Our college claims that there are 100% placement results every year. Top recruiting companies for our course are Qualcomm, Caterpillar, Oracle, Cisco, SAP Labs, etc. Many of the students get an internship in top companies like Qualcomm, Caterpillar, etc. Top roles offered here are hardware engineer, software engineer and systems engineer. In 2019, we got the highest salary package of 38 LPA in Microsoft. The average salary package offered is 4 LPA.
Infrastructure: The infrastructure is extraordinary here, and there are great labs and good facilities. There is a high-speed internet facility in our labs where we can access and use the internet for productive purpose. Classrooms are good with good ventilation. The library is somewhat fine, but a huge library is under construction. Hostel facilities are good, and the rooms are good enough. The food served here is comparatively better than the food served in other colleges. There are good medical facilities, a good ground, an indoor court for badminton, table tennis and chess. There is also a gym.
Faculty: Teachers here are very knowledgeable and highly qualified. Their teaching is extraordinary, and we can approach them personally for any help either be in personal life or academics. They will do help with pleasure, and they not only behave as teachers but also behave as friends. The course curriculum is provided by Anna University. So, if students need to be ready for the industry, they must try on their own with the help of facilities provided by the college. However, faculty members help students to become industry-ready.
Other: I loved electronics right from my childhood and was mesmerised by the communication technologies like 5G, etc., so I chose electronics and communication engineering. Everything is already good here, so there is no need to improve anything. Our college organises fests like intra-college fest named Advaya, national level technical symposium named Yuktaha, sports day named Sudeva and annual day named Dhaksha. Our college also celebrates events like Pongal, Onam, Golu, etc.

Q:   What is the application fee for the B.Tech. program at PSG Institute of Technology and Applied Research?
A: 

The Tamil Nadu Engineering Admissions (TNEA) process is responsible for the determination of the application fee in the case of the B.Tech program at PSG Institute of Technology and Applied Research. TNEA examination fee is Rs. 500 for open category students and Rs 250 for SC, ST, SCA students and PH students are exempted from the fee. This fee is mandatory to apply through the TNEA portal because PSG Institute of Technology and Applied Research do not conduct any separate applications for B.Tech admissions.

Q:   What are the documents required for admission to PSG Institute of Technology and Applied Research?
A: 

The following documents are required for admission to the PSG Institute of Technology and Applied Research: 

A recent, clear and scanned passport-size photograph and signature in JPG and JPEG format.

Marksheet of Secondary Education or 10th class and marksheet of higher secondary school or 12th class.

School transfer certificate or migration certificate any of them.

Nativity Certificate - It is need to know your actual birth and residential state, if you are a Tamil Nadu resident but completed studies in another state provide the original certificate as a Tamil Nadu resident.

For more information, you can contact the college's admission cell.
